Located 60 miles (96 kilometers) southeast of Anchorage, the Whittier cruise port is the beginning and end point of many Alaskan cruises. The road from Anchorage to Whittier follows the Turnagain Arm of the Gulf of Alaska and is one of the most scenic drives in Alaska. How to get to Anchorage from the Whittier Cruise Port

Many cruise companies provide transportation from Whittier to Anchorage, and many companies provide private sightseeing transfers as well. The Alaska Railroad also offers service from Anchorage to Whittier, and most shore excursions include transportation from the cruise terminal.

Port information

Whittier is the cruise port closest to Anchorage. Whittier is located on the northeastern shore of the Kenai Peninsula on Prince William Sound. Services are limited in Whittier, so most cruise passengers stay in Anchorage before or after their cruise. The US dollar is the currency, and English is the official language.
